Murali Swaminathan serves as the Vice President of ITSM and SPM Engineering at ServiceNow, where he plays a pivotal role in shaping the future of IT Service Management and Strategic Portfolio Management products. With over 30 years of experience in the technology sector, Murali has a profound understanding of cloud computing, program management, and product lifecycle management, which he leverages to drive innovation and operational excellence within his teams. Under his leadership, the ITSM and SPM portfolios have not only generated over $4 billion in revenue but have also become essential tools for thousands of organizations worldwide, enabling them to streamline operations and enhance service delivery.
Murali's expertise in Scrum methodologies and service-oriented architecture (SOA) allows him to foster agile development practices, ensuring that his teams can rapidly respond to market demands and customer needs.
